Wired for sound…and power…and data and… e-textiles

From the BBC comes a report on “e-textiles” that can provide clothes with a single, central power source to charge devices. You say Tamaggo, I say Tamarggo…360° Handheld Pictures

Tamaggo

Scheduled for release later this  year, the Tamagoo 360-imager is capable of taking panoramas in sky/ground, horizontal or vertical panoramic planes.  With a 14MP sensor, 2″ LCD touch screen and built-in WiFi, the unit is 92 x 55.8 x 61.1mm and weighs in at around 190g.
